PSR-Solutions in London is seeking a Junior Proposals Coordinator to join their bids/proposals and business development team.
You will coordinate and produce tender submissions, presentations and marketing materials, ensuring proposals are visually engaging, accurate and well-structured.
Ideal candidates are recent graduates in Graphic Design or related fields, with strong layout, typography and presentation skills.

How to prepare for a job interview at Psr-Solutions
✨Get Your Portfolio Ready
Your portfolio is your secret weapon in graphic design interviews! Make sure it's showing off your best work, with a variety of styles and projects that highlight different skills — from branding to digital illustration. Be prepared to talk through each piece, focusing on your creative process and the tools you used.
✨Know Your Design Tools Inside Out
Familiarity with software like Adobe Creative Suite is a must! Brush up on your skills with Photoshop, Illustrator, and InDesign, as interviewers might dive into specific technical questions or ask for your workflow. If you’ve worked with any innovative tools or techniques, don't hesitate to showcase that expertise!
✨Prepare for Design Challenges
Some companies may throw a design challenge your way during the interview! This might involve sketching out ideas or solving a branding issue on the spot. Practising these quick thinking exercises beforehand can help us show off our creativity and adaptability.
